Yes, the online installation seems to leave the zipped model file intact (although it should probably delete it to save space), and that can also be used with the Install model from zip. The model repository is acting a bit weird now, I can download the model files in a browser, but the online installation in OPUS-CAT is not working. I assume that things will return to normal fairly soon. In the meantime it's possible to install models by downloading their zip files from https://github.com/Helsinki-NLP/Tatoeba-Challenge/tree/master/models and then using Install model from zip.
